Markdown Syntax Cheat Sheet
| You type | You get | Toolbar |
|---|---|---|
| # Title | Heading 1 | H1 |
| **text** | Bold text | B |
| *text* | Italic text | I |
| - item | Bulleted list | List |
| [label](url) | A link | Link |
